Last week, New York Governor Andrew Cuomo signed a law that will allow schools in New York State to install cameras on the stop arms of school buses. The cameras are intended to automatically record anyone who passes a school bus illegally. Continue reading “New York Implements Installation of Cameras on School Buses”

Steep Penalties for Driving Without Insurance in New York
Hundreds of thousands of motorists use New York’s roadways each day. In New York, each vehicle on its roads must be covered by an auto insurance policy to properly adhere to the traffic and insurance laws within the state. However, in 2015, there was an estimated 6.1% of motorists within the state that continued to drive without proper auto insurance in place. This can result in harsh penalties.

Suffolk County Committee Decides to Extend Red-Light Camera Program
On September 19, 2018, Newsday reported that the Suffolk County Legislature’s Waiver Committee unanimously voted in favor of extending the contract of the county’s red-light camera vendor, resulting in the red-light camera program being extended for at least another year.
Conduent Inc., a technology company based in Florham Park, New Jersey, received an extension on its contract with the county which will run the end of 2019. Republican legislators were upset that the contract was renewed without seeking competitive bids or requests for proposal, but they are more upset that the red-light camera program is more about collecting revenues than making the roads safer for drivers.
